Beef & lentil bolognese

Half beef, half lentils for a big hit of well-absorbed and plant iron with plenty of protein.

Serves 4 · Ready in 35 min · Rich in Iron, Protein

Ingredients

  • 250g lean beef mince
  • 1 cup cooked brown lentils
  • 1 onion,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, crushed
  • 400g can crushed tomatoes
  • 1 tbsp tomato paste
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p dried oregano

Method

  1. Brown the mince in the oil, then set aside.
  2. Soften the onion and garlic, then stir in the tomato paste and oregano.
  3. Return the mince, add the lentils, tomatoes and a splash of water. Simmer 20 minutes.
  4. Serve over pasta or vegetable noodles.

Tip: Stretching mince with lentils lifts the iron and fibre while keeping the cost down. Serve over gluten-free pasta or zucchini noodles.

Roughly per serve

  • Iron: 6 mg
  • Protein: 28 g
  • Folate: 90 µg
  • Choline: 80 mg

Approximate per-serve estimates from AUSNUT and USDA food-composition data, a general guide, not individual advice.
